Evaluating the Damage
Upon finding water damage, the primary step is to completely analyze the degree of the impact. This initial evaluation is critical, as it assists establish the required actions for effective cleaning and remediation. Begin by evaluating the affected locations, including wall surfaces, ceilings, floors, and personal items, to identify the resource of the water invasion, whether from flooding, leakages, or condensation.
Documenting the damage is crucial for both insurance coverage cases and preparing reconstruction efforts - damage restoration services. Usage pictures and composed notes to catch the severity of the damages, keeping in mind any kind of affected architectural components and materials. Pay special interest to locations that might not be right away noticeable, such as behind wall surfaces and under carpets, as hidden wetness can lead to further issues, consisting of mold and mildew growth
Additionally, evaluate the timeline of the water direct exposure. Eventually, a detailed evaluation lays the foundation for an effective water damage clean-up process, guaranteeing that all affected areas are dealt with efficiently and completely.
Water Extraction Methods

Specialists normally utilize submersible pumps for larger volumes of water, which can swiftly minimize flooding in basements or various other impacted locations. For smaller amounts, wet/dry vacuums are frequently used to remove residual dampness from rugs and hard surface areas. Furthermore, making use of portable extractors permits targeted removal in constrained rooms or areas with fragile materials.
In instances of infected water, such as sewage or floodwater, progressed extraction strategies may involve the usage of biohazard devices to guarantee safety and security and compliance with wellness guidelines. High-powered extraction tools are crucial in lessening water retention in architectural materials, which can bring about mold development and architectural degeneration if not resolved quickly.
Ultimately, the efficiency of water extraction methods plays a pivotal function in the overall success of the water damage clean-up procedure, laying the groundwork for succeeding restoration initiatives.
Drying and Dehumidification
Once standing water has actually been properly extracted, the next essential phase in the water damage clean-up procedure is drying out and dehumidification. This action is necessary to stop further damage and mold growth, which can happen within 24 to 2 days in wet environments.
To achieve efficient drying, specific tools such as industrial-grade air moving companies and dehumidifiers is used. Air moving companies distribute air throughout wet surfaces, enhancing evaporation rates, while dehumidifiers decrease humidity levels in the air, promoting a conducive environment for drying. The combination of these devices guarantees that moisture is drawn out from floors, home furnishings, and wall surfaces, allowing them to completely dry extensively.
It is necessary to keep track of the drying out procedure very closely. Professionals usually use moisture meters to assess the moisture material in different materials, making sure that all impacted areas reach appropriate dry skin levels. This precise strategy aids to protect against hidden moisture pockets that could bring about architectural damage or unhealthy mold and mildew growth.

Cleansing and Sterilizing
After the drying and dehumidification stage is total, the next essential action in water damage clean-up is cleaning and disinfecting the impacted locations. This procedure is vital to stop the development of mold, microorganisms, and other virus that thrive in moist environments.
The cleaning stage generally entails removing any kind of debris, dirt, and impurities from surfaces utilizing specialized cleaning agents. For difficult surfaces, a combination of soap and water or business cleaning products is often utilized. Soft products, such as upholstery and carpetings, might call for much more comprehensive cleansing techniques, including vapor cleaning or deep removal techniques, to make certain extensive hygiene.

Disinfecting complies with cleansing, making use of EPA-approved disinfectants to eliminate damaging bacteria. This action is crucial, specifically in locations that might have entered into contact with floodwaters or sewage, as these resources can pose serious health risks.
Additionally, it is necessary to deal with any type of staying odors, which may need making use of odor neutralizers or advanced techniques like ozone therapy. Correct cleansing and disinfecting not just bring back the security and hygiene of your home but also prepared for effective reconstruction and fixings in succeeding phases of the water damages clean-up procedure.
